Output 6f3a4def497a822dc8f7203f29eb78489204cc7a983b33ea25f30a7ac070c446:16

value
151990000
script pubkey
OP_0 OP_PUSHBYTES_20 3aab68c26f652677c728a89b022eedcc6bbc08bf
address
ltc1q824k3sn0v5n803eg4zdsythde34mcz9lp3zxgg
transaction
6f3a4def497a822dc8f7203f29eb78489204cc7a983b33ea25f30a7ac070c446
spent
true